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a short-term d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and have the waste hauled away. But if you want your waste recycled, you might have to go about it in a slightly different style. Waste in most temporary dumpsters isn't recycled because the containers are so big and hold so much stuff.
If you're interested in recycling any waste from your job, check into getting smaller containers. Many dumpster rental businesses in Duluth have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. These are generally smaller than temporary dumpsters; they are the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
If you'd like to recycle, learn if the company you are working with uses single stream recycling (you do not have to sort the substance) or in the event that you'll need to organize the recyclable stuff into distinct contain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to make a difference in the variety of containers you have to rent.
What's the largest size dumpster accessible?
The largest roll off dumpster that businesses usually rent is a 40 yard container. This enormous d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limitation on 40 yard containers typically 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be quite aware of the limitation and do your best not to exceed it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age charges, which add up quickly.
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will likely be the right size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of rubbish when you're moving in or out House demolition New house building Commercial and residential cleanouts

10 yard dumpster dimensions in Duluth
A 10 yard dumpster is constructed to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will change with different companies.
It may be difficult to select just the container size you'll need for your house project,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ller clean-up jobs.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a basement or garage A 250 square foot deck which has been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you don't need an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function perfectly.
Long-Term vs Rolloff dumpsters
Whether or not you need a long-term or roll off dumpster depends upon the kind of job and service you'll need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for ongoing needs that last longer than just a day or two. This includes things like day to day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is simply what the name suggests; a one-time demand for job-special waste removal.
Temporary roll-off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be used. All these are usually larger containers that could manage all the waste that comes with that particular job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are generally smaller containers because they are emptied on a regular basis and so don't need to hold as much at one time.
If you request a permanent dumpster, some companies need at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Rolloff dumpsters just require a rental fee for the time that you just maintain the dumpster on the job.

What if I want my dumpster in Duluth picked up early?
When you make arrangements to rent a dumpster in Duluth, part of your rental agreement comprises a given duration of time you're permitted to use the container. You usually base this time on the length of time you think your project might take. The bigger the job, the the more time you'll need the dumpster. Most dumpster rental firms in Duluth give you a rate for a particular number of days. Should you exceed that quantity of days, you'll pay an additional fee per day. If the job goes more rapidly than expected, you may be finished with the dumpster sooner than you anticipated.
If this really is the case, give the dumpster company a call and they'll probably come pick your container up early; this will permit them to rent it to someone else more fast. You generally will not get a discount on your rate should you ask for early pick-up. Your rental fee includes 7 days (or whatever your term is), whether you use them all or not.
What's the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have features that make them useful for different types of occupations.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They normally have open tops and also a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ms tilt to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is a useful option for companies that accumulate consid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are usually left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. That makes it possible for sanitation professionals to eliminate garbage and trash for multiple homes and companies in the area at reasonable prices.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could cause it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things shouldn't st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you are done.
4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y items to the dumpster.
6. Simply let adults close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ure to have lots of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If you intend to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.
How far in advance do I have to reserve my dumpster?
As with any service, it's almost always a great plan to allow your dumpster as far ahead as you possibly can in order to make sure that the dumpster will be available when you need it. If you wait until the final minute, there is no promise that the company will soon have the ability to fill your order.
Two or three days notice is usually adequate to ensure your dumpster delivery in time. Keep in mind that the most active days are usually on Mondays and Fridays (surrounding the weekend), so if you can plan your project for the midst of the week, you've a increased possibility of finding the dumpster you need.
Should you find out you need a dumpster the following day or even the same day, please go ahead and call the business. If they have what you need, they will surely make arrangements to get it to you as soon as possible.

What is the lowest size dumpster accessible?
The lowest size roll-off dumpster commonly accessible is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ent option for small-scale projects, for example little house cleanouts.
Other examples of projects that a 10 yard container would work nicely for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of waste Be aware that weight constraints for the containers are imposed,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ional charges.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in can help you take care of small projects around the house. When you have a larger project coming up, take a peek at some larger containers also.
